How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Ridgeview?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
Ridgeview Studio Apartments | $1,455 | $1,007 | $6,246 |
| Ridgeview 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,831 | $1,015 | $7,358 |
| Ridgeview 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,511 | $1,450 | $10,000+ |
| Ridgeview 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,151 | $1,925 | $5,875 |
| Ridgeview 4 Bedroom Apartments | $7,543 | $7,543 | $7,543 |

Largest Available Ridgeview Studio Apartments
The largest available Studio apartment unit in the Ridgeview area of Atlanta, GA is found at High Street Atlanta and is listed at 637 square feet priced from $1,995. Here is today’s list of the largest available 2 Bedroom units in the area: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Square Footage |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| High Street Atlanta | S4 | 637 Sq Ft | $1,995 |
| Manor Chamblee | S1 | 617 Sq Ft | $1,680 |
| 1160 Hammond | S1 | 578 Sq Ft | $1,399 |
| The Linc Brookhaven | A | 543 Sq Ft | $1,453 |
| MAA Brookhaven | Studio 0x1 522-535 SF | 535 Sq Ft | $1,120 |
| Gables Brookhaven | S1 | 465 Sq Ft | $1,451 |
| The Atlantic Ashford | S1B | 457 Sq Ft | $1,064 |
Cheapest Available Ridgeview Studio Apartments
Currently the lowest priced Studio apartment unit Ridgeview of Atlanta, GA is the S1A Model starting from $1,007 at The Atlantic Ashford. The average price for all Studio apartments in Ridgeview is currently $1,455.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available Studio options in the area: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
|---|---|---|
| The Atlantic Ashford | S1A | $1,007 |
| MAA Brookhaven | Studio 0x1 522-535 SF | $1,120 |
| 1160 Hammond | S1 | $1,399 |
| Gables Brookhaven | S1 | $1,451 |
| The Linc Brookhaven | A | $1,453 |
| Manor Chamblee | S1 | $1,680 |
| High Street Atlanta | S4 | $1,995 |
